主页>IDC频道>

阅读新闻

来源:官方 作者: 日期:2025-12-06 14:44:21 点击: 261393次

Giới thiệu

Trong bối cảnh công nghệ ngày càng phát triển, việc tối ưu hóa hiệu suất và thiết kế kiến trúc sẵn sàng cao cho các ứng dụng trở nên cực kỳ quan trọng. Bài báo này sẽ phân tích kỹ thuật về các điểm nghẽn hiệu suất và các giải pháp kiến trúc sẵn sàng cao cho vé số 10.000, một ứng dụng phổ biến trong ngành công nghiệp xổ số.

1. Kiểm thử hiệu suất và phân tích chỉ số

1.1. Kiểm thử hiệu suất

Kiểm thử hiệu suất là quá trình đánh giá khả năng của một hệ thống trong việc xử lý tải công việc khác nhau. Đối với vé số 10.000, chúng tôi đã thực hiện một loạt các bài kiểm tra hiệu suất để xác định các điểm nghẽn trong hệ thống. Các phương pháp kiểm thử bao gồm:

- Kiểm thử tải: Đánh giá khả năng của hệ thống khi xử lý số lượng lớn người dùng đồng thời.

- Kiểm thử stress: Xác định giới hạn của hệ thống bằng cách tăng tải cho đến khi hệ thống gặp sự cố.

- Kiểm thử hồi quy: Đảm bảo rằng các tính năng cũ vẫn hoạt động tốt khi có sự thay đổi trong mã nguồn.

1.2. Phân tích chỉ số

Sau khi thực hiện kiểm thử, chúng tôi đã thu thập và phân tích các chỉ số hiệu suất như thời gian phản hồi, thông lượng và tỷ lệ lỗi. Các chỉ số này giúp xác định các điểm nghẽn trong hệ thống, từ đó đề xuất các giải pháp cải thiện.

Đường cong hiệu suất

2. Thiết kế kiến trúc sẵn sàng cao và chiến lược phục hồi sau thảm họa

2.1. Kiến trúc sẵn sàng cao

Để đảm bảo tính liên tục trong hoạt động, hệ thống vé số 10.000 cần được thiết kế với kiến trúc sẵn sàng cao. Một số yếu tố quan trọng bao gồm:

- Phân tán dữ liệu: Sử dụng nhiều máy chủ và cơ sở dữ liệu để giảm thiểu rủi ro mất dữ liệu.

- Cân bằng tải: Phân phối tải công việc đều giữa các máy chủ để tối ưu hóa hiệu suất.

- Tự động hóa: Áp dụng các công cụ tự động để phát hiện và khắc phục sự cố nhanh chóng.

2.2. Chiến lược phục hồi sau thảm họa

Một chiến lược phục hồi sau thảm họa hiệu quả bao gồm:

- Sao lưu định kỳ: Thực hiện sao lưu dữ liệu thường xuyên để đảm bảo khả năng phục hồi.

- Kế hoạch phục hồi: Xây dựng một kế hoạch chi tiết để khôi phục hệ thống trong trường hợp gặp sự cố nghiêm trọng.

- Thử nghiệm định kỳ: Thực hiện các bài kiểm tra phục hồi để đảm bảo rằng kế hoạch hoạt động hiệu quả.

Sơ đồ cấu trúc

3. Các giải pháp tối ưu hóa và giám sát liên tục

3.1. Giải pháp tối ưu hóa

Để cải thiện hiệu suất của hệ thống, một số giải pháp tối ưu hóa đã được áp dụng:

- Tối ưu hóa mã nguồn: Phân tích và tối ưu hóa mã nguồn để giảm thiểu thời gian xử lý.

- Sử dụng bộ nhớ đệm: Tận dụng bộ nhớ đệm để giảm thiểu thời gian truy cập dữ liệu.

- Tối ưu hóa truy vấn cơ sở dữ liệu: Cải thiện các truy vấn SQL để giảm thiểu thời gian phản hồi.

3.2. Giám sát liên tục

Giám sát liên tục là một phần quan trọng trong việc duy trì hiệu suất của hệ thống. Các công cụ giám sát có thể giúp theo dõi các chỉ số hiệu suất theo thời gian thực, từ đó phát hiện và xử lý sự cố kịp thời. Các chỉ số cần theo dõi bao gồm:

- Tình trạng máy chủ: Theo dõi CPU, bộ nhớ và băng thông của máy chủ.

- Thời gian phản hồi: Đo lường thời gian phản hồi của các yêu cầu từ người dùng.

- Tỷ lệ lỗi: Theo dõi tỷ lệ lỗi để phát hiện các vấn đề tiềm ẩn trong hệ thống.

Giám sát hiệu suất

Kết luận

Bài báo này đãThông-tin-bài viết phân tích các điểm nghẽn hiệu suất và kiến trúc sẵn sàng cao của vé số 10.000. Qua việc kiểm thử hiệu suất, phân tích chỉ số, thiết kế kiến trúc sẵn sàng cao và áp dụng các giải pháp tối ưu hóa, chúng ta có thể cải thiện đáng kể hiệu suất và độ tin cậy của hệ thống. Việc giám sát liên tục cũng đóng vai trò quan trọng trong việc duy trì hiệu suất và phát hiện sớm các vấn đề, từ đó đảm bảo trải nghiệm tốt nhất cho người dùng.

    数据统计中!!
    ------分隔线----------------------------
    发表评论
    请自觉遵守互联网相关的政策法规,严禁发布色情、暴力、反动的言论。
    评价:
    表情:
    验证码:点击我更换图片匿名?

    推荐内容

    热点内容